1265 (RH-103)
Baseband Description and Troubleshooting

Troubleshooting

First, carry out a through visual check of the module. Make sure in particular
that:
There is no mechanical damage.
Soldered joints are OK.
ASIC orientations are OK.
The following hints should help find the cause of the problem when the
circuitry seems to be faulty. Troubleshooting instructions are divided into the
following sections:
"Mobile Terminal is Dead"
"Flash Faults"
"Power Does Not Stay ON or the Mobile Terminal is Jammed"
"Charger Faults"
"Audio Faults"
"Display Faults"
"Keypad Faults"
Note:
QSC6010 is underfilled and can not be replaced.
Memory IC is underfilled and can not be replaced.
The Shielding Cover can not be reused after removal.
After using the heat gun, the domesheet needs to be replaced.
